Your work matters. But it won’t sell itself. In this episode, I’m joined by Tiffany Neuman, visionary branding strategist and creator of the Brand Operating System™, to talk about what it really takes to turn your message into a movement.

After nearly 20 years leading creative direction for brands like Adidas and Burt’s Bees, Tiffany now helps speakers, authors, coaches, and consultants step fully into their visibility and build brands that create lasting impact.

We talk about the quiet ways heart-centered entrepreneurs dim their light, why visibility feels uncomfortable (especially when you don’t want to feel salesy), and how owning your brand is an act of stewardship, not ego. This is a powerful conversation about responsibility, clarity, and building something bigger than just offers.
